1.1 Several different types of compression gaskets are available for use in connection with hub and spigot cast iron soil pipe and fittings. The purpose of this test method is to establish material criteria and test procedures for compression gaskets used in joining hub and spigot cast iron soil pipe and fittings for sanitary drain, waste, vent, and storm drain piping applications in accordance with the general needs of producers, distributors, and users.

This test method covers the standard material criteria and test method for compression gaskets used in joining hub and spigot cast iron soil pipe and fittings for sanitary drain, waste, vent, and storm piping applications. The gaskets shall be made of a compound containing a thermoset elastomer and shall consist of one or more sealing ring(s) that compress to provide an airtight and watertight seal. Compression gaskets shall have an integral flange to prevent the gasket from rolling into the hub during installation and shall be designed to permit expansion, contraction, and deflection of assembled piping. The gaskets shall be restrained and subjected to hydrostatic pressure and the joint assembly performance shall be evaluated using the restrained hydrostatic joint testing apparatus wherein a water pressure gauge is used to ensure the accuracy of the test pressures.
